How does Indiana's school choice programs, like the Choice Scholarship (voucher) program, benefit Bennington families considering private schools?

Indiana's robust Choice Scholarship program can significantly offset tuition costs for eligible Bennington families. To qualify, a family's income must generally be below 150% of the amount required for the federal free or reduced-price lunch program, with higher thresholds for students with special needs or those leaving a public school assigned an "F" grade. Since many top-rated private options are out-of-district, securing a voucher is often essential to make them financially feasible. It's crucial to confirm that your chosen private school (even one in Kentucky) participates in the Indiana voucher program, as not all out-of-state schools do.

For a family in Bennington, what are the major practical considerations when comparing a local public school to a private school requiring a long-distance commute?

The decision involves weighing daily logistics against educational philosophy. The local public schools (likely within the Switzerland County School District or similar) offer proximity, no tuition, and community-based extracurriculars. Opting for a private school in Louisville or Indianapolis means committing to a daily commute of 1-3 hours roundtrip, which impacts family time, extracurricular participation, and transportation costs. Parents must evaluate if the private school's specific academic rigor, religious foundation, or specialized programs justify this significant investment of time and resources. Additionally, for high school students, a long commute can limit their ability to engage in after-school sports or clubs at the private school.
